Hi - my name is Spunky, I'm a small Chihuahua (CKC papers were given to
YCHS when he was surredered) who is
looking for a forever family. I was
surrendered to YCHS with a female Chihuahua named Sadie - our caregiver
had some health issues and wasn't able to keep us.
I'm
well-socialized and don't bark at strangers. I was very overweight when I came into foster care,
but with proper food portions and exercising, I'm loosing weight and feeling much better. I've been neutered
and had a dental cleaning as well. I'm heartworm negative and
up-to-date on all of my vaccinations. I weigh approximately nine pounds.

Appointments to be introduced to animals in foster care can be arranged with foster parents to meet your schedule; however, please keep in mind that most of our foster parents do work full-time. If you would like to see an animal in foster care, please contact their foster parent through the email address provided in the animal's bio. Adoption fees are $75 for kittens/cats and $100 for puppies/dogs - this includes age appropriate vaccinations, de-worming, and the spay/neuter.
